Fish aplenty during festive season

Adequate stocks of fish would be made available to all regional centres of the Ceylon Fisheries Corporation (CFC) during the festive season.

The CFC has made elaborate arrangements to dispatch adequate stocks to meet the demand of customers at regional level.

Commenting on the scarcity of fish in the market during this season due to the prevailing bad weather conditions, a CFC official said the Corporation has engaged a mobile fleet to meet the demand in predominant Christian areas.

A kilogram of tuna fish will be sold at Rs 350 through all regional stalls and mobile stalls of the CFC during Christmas and New Year.

Extensive stocks are available at the Modera CFC main stores for wholesale dealers, the official explained.

'However, prices of prawns, crabs and lobsters are fairly high as usual due to the demand by tourist hotels, especially during the Christmas and New year season," the official added.
